summaryrefslogtreecommitdiff
path: root/lc
diff options
context:
space:
mode:
authorPéter Diviánszky <divipp@gmail.com>2016-01-15 11:46:36 +0100
committerPéter Diviánszky <divipp@gmail.com>2016-01-15 11:46:44 +0100
commit79b39b990001f896154da529520015a0915dff64 (patch)
tree47d02a14ea62ea4fdd9615e771e0fd6f880bb288 /lc
parent077c178d45a602b24b55294d4ba609a71f1880af (diff)
modify hw example & add TODO item
Diffstat (limited to 'lc')
-rw-r--r--lc/Builtins.lc5
1 files changed, 4 insertions, 1 deletions
diff --git a/lc/Builtins.lc b/lc/Builtins.lc
index 88b90d57..502f040b 100644
--- a/lc/Builtins.lc
+++ b/lc/Builtins.lc
@@ -577,7 +577,10 @@ filterFragmentStream = FilteredFragmentStream
577transformFragmentsRastDepth f = ShadedFragmentStream (FragmentShaderRastDepth f) 577transformFragmentsRastDepth f = ShadedFragmentStream (FragmentShaderRastDepth f)
578accumulateWith ctx x = (ctx, x) 578accumulateWith ctx x = (ctx, x)
579overlay cl (ctx, str) = Accumulate ctx str cl 579overlay cl (ctx, str) = Accumulate ctx str cl
580transformVertices f s = Transform (\v -> VertexOut (f v) 1 () (Smooth v)) s 580transformVertices0 f () s = Transform (\v -> VertexOut (f v) 1 () ()) s
581transformVertices1 f g1 s = Transform (\v -> VertexOut (f v) 1 () (Smooth (g1 v))) s
582transformVertices2 f (g1, g2) s = Transform (\v -> VertexOut (f v) 1 () (Smooth (g1 v), Smooth (g2 v))) s
583transformVertices3 f (g1, g2, g3) s = Transform (\v -> VertexOut (f v) 1 () (Smooth (g1 v), Smooth (g2 v), Smooth (g3 v))) s
581renderFrame = ScreenOut 584renderFrame = ScreenOut
582imageFrame = FrameBuffer 585imageFrame = FrameBuffer
583emptyDepthImage = DepthImage @1 586emptyDepthImage = DepthImage @1